For those of you who aren't aware of the sacrifices required to get a custom template, I feel obliged to fill you in. In the Alliance's current state, we edit the site and update content using Freewebs' page editing system. A point-and-click interface involving Rich Text and HTML paragraphs that make up a page with a set, uneditable template already in place throughout the site. In order to use a custom template, we'll have to take advantage of the feature that allows us to convert the entire site - the template, pages, links, images, everything - into raw HTML. Each page on the site exists as a text file (*.txt) in our Uploaded Files section. The plus side is that, not only can we create our own template, but we can (feasibly, but not likely) alter the contents of any page and even create different templates for individual pages. The downside, however, is that there's no way to go back to the original editor, and displaying pages from text documents takes up bandwidth. Aside from that, Mike and I are mediocre at best when it comes to HTML... but hopefully we'll work things out well enough to make sure the site looks and runs smoothly.
